Transaction 68a78aa2fc91d5bdfe48f6d56684efdbfe8fb7e6460dd63a6b558827d9143c96
1 Input
1 Output
-
68a78aa2fc91d5bdfe48f6d56684efdbfe8fb7e6460dd63a6b558827d9143c96:0
- value
- 639700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e7fdbbe2a03458592eab9f4cab355fe63b2813b OP_EQUAL
- address
- 3DDtEUCM29y3cuntmR5Up5LQNaVAfoH1S3